Cone Penetration Test(CPT)has speed quick,data continuous,emersion good,operation convenience etc.advantage.As an important in-situ soil testing method,CPT has been accepted by more and more geotechnical engineers.This paper first analyzes and introduces the development, present condition and theories foundation of CPT. Combine the practice in liaoning to explore the application of CPT.This paper research work and result as follows:1. Combine the project experience of soft soil area in Liaoning,analysising the reliability and economical of Cone Penetration Test in evaluation Physical mechanical properties of soil.2. Analyze the characteristics of CPT curves of the subsoils with different origin periods in Liaoning-dandong soft soil area. Verify the naming of subsoils by CPT parameters.3. Verify the conversion formulas of the specific penetration resistance and cone tip resistance.4. Correlation analysis of CPT parameters and physical and mechanical indexes of subsoils, empirical formulas research between CPT parameters and subsoil specific weight,modulus of viscosity and Undrained shear modulus.5. Summary the foundation soil of bearing capacity, compr modulus(Es)related formula,after pass this empirical formula calculation, get the strength parameter of with distortion parameters to match more actual circumstance.Based on the above mentioned analysis and study, the paper summarizes the characteristics of CPT curves of the subsoils with different origin periods in liaoning soft soil area, which can provide regional experiences for CPT soil classification and layer division and suggests a conversion formula for the specific penetration resistance and cone tip resistance;establishes the correlative formulas between the cone tip resistance qc and subsoil specific weightγ, modulus of compressibility Es, modulus of viscosity and Undrained shear modulus.These formulas have been verified in actual engineering projects and have proved rational and applicable.
